    Patients often ask whether drinking more water can help their back pain, having heard that spinal discs are largely made of water and that dehydration might contribute to disc problems. The relationship is real, though it is more nuanced than a simple prescription of eight glasses a day fixing disc-related pain. Understanding how hydration actually relates to spinal disc health helps put this piece of the puzzle in proper context alongside other factors that affect disc integrity.

    The Basic Composition of Spinal Discs

    Each disc between the vertebrae has a tough outer ring called the annulus fibrosus surrounding a soft, gel-like center called the nucleus pulposus. This inner nucleus is composed largely of water, along with proteins and other structural molecules that help it retain that water and function as a shock-absorbing cushion between vertebrae. A well-hydrated disc maintains the height and cushioning capacity needed to properly distribute load across the spine and protect surrounding structures from excessive stress.

    How Discs Naturally Lose Water Over Time

    Spinal discs are largely avascular, meaning they lack a direct blood supply and instead rely on diffusion of fluid and nutrients from surrounding tissue to maintain their water content. As part of normal aging, discs gradually lose some of their water-retaining capacity, becoming somewhat thinner and less able to cushion the spine as effectively as they did in youth.

    This natural process, called disc degeneration, happens to some degree in virtually everyone as they age and is a major contributor to age-related back pain and stiffness, separate from any dehydration in the everyday sense of not drinking enough fluids.

    Does Drinking More Water Actually Rehydrate Discs

    This is where the evidence becomes more nuanced than popular wellness advice sometimes suggests. While severe, prolonged systemic dehydration can theoretically affect the fluid available to tissues throughout the body, including discs, there is limited direct evidence that simply increasing water intake beyond normal, adequate hydration meaningfully reverses disc degeneration or significantly rehydrates discs that have already lost water content through natural aging or injury.

    Disc hydration is influenced by a complex interplay of genetics, mechanical loading patterns, and the disc’s capacity to retain fluid, not simply by how much water passes through the body in a given day.

    Why Adequate Hydration Still Matters

    Despite this nuance, maintaining adequate overall hydration remains a reasonable and healthy practice that supports general tissue health throughout the body, including whatever capacity discs retain to exchange fluid with surrounding tissue. Chronic, significant dehydration affects blood volume, circulation, and the function of virtually every tissue system, and there is no reasonable argument for staying inadequately hydrated.

    The key distinction is between maintaining normal, healthy hydration, which is worthwhile, and expecting that drinking extra water beyond normal needs will meaningfully reverse existing disc degeneration, which is not well supported by current evidence.

    Other Factors With Stronger Evidence for Disc Health

    Several other factors have more substantial evidence behind their impact on disc health than hydration alone. Regular movement and exercise help maintain the mechanical loading patterns that support healthy nutrient exchange in discs, since discs rely partly on the pumping action created by movement to exchange fluid with surrounding tissue. Maintaining a healthy body weight reduces mechanical stress on discs.

    Avoiding smoking is significant, since smoking has been specifically linked to accelerated disc degeneration through its effects on blood flow and nutrient delivery to disc tissue. Proper body mechanics during lifting and prolonged sitting also play meaningful roles in protecting disc health over the long term.

    A Reasonable, Evidence-Based Approach

    For patients interested in supporting spinal disc health, a sensible approach includes maintaining normal, adequate hydration as part of overall health, without expecting it to be a standalone solution for existing disc problems, combined with regular movement, maintaining a healthy weight, avoiding smoking, and using good body mechanics. This combination reflects what the current evidence actually supports, rather than placing outsized expectations on hydration alone to resolve disc-related back pain.

    When Disc-Related Pain Needs Medical Evaluation

    Hydration and lifestyle factors are useful supportive measures, but they are not a substitute for medical evaluation when disc-related pain is significant, persistent, or accompanied by symptoms like radiating leg pain, numbness, or weakness. A proper evaluation can determine the specific nature of disc involvement and guide an appropriate, evidence-based treatment plan rather than relying solely on hydration or other general wellness measures.
